Walkin'

Looking for something a little more in budget? Why don't you first try the blue hills reservation - it's very near Boston itself, and offers some amazingly unique sights and sounds. Take a trail and appreciate nature for no cost at all.

Afterwards, stop at Mike's Pastry, on Hanover Street (300 Hanover Street). Stroll, if you'd like, and explore the small store fronts. You can great different pastries, or perhaps just a cappuccino at Mike's, for little cost.

Haymarket Fun

Want something more day-time friendly? Why don't you spend a Friday or Saturday at the Haymarket? Countless flock to it each weekend, not only for the excitement of finding something new - but for the prices that beat any supermarket in the area.

Haggle with the local venders, and move with a huge crowd as you grab different fresh, organic foods. Afterwards, head to your home (Or, if you're planning a visit, stay at an extended stay-style hotel that will have a kitchen-ette) and cook a meal from what you've purchased.

It's healthy, it's fun, and there's a lot of bonding time that you get to spend together. Besides, how many people can say that they've done something like this?
